If one plays regular deuces wild, 98.91 paytable, and has a 500 dollar bankroll...
olds442jetaway wrote:
Sun Mar 10, 2019 11:43 am
If i play 5 quarters for 4000 hands on the same 98.91 game, whatare chances I will bust the 500 budget?

8% chance you will go completely bust in 4000 hands.
67% chance you will end up down after 4000 hands (including going broke).
33% chance you come out ahead.

You would increase your odds of coming out ahead if you also set a point that you'd be willing to quit if you were up a certain amount.

How much you are up and down would of course vary, so that has to be taken into consideration. The most you could be down would be $500. You could obviously be up more than that with a royal.

Much of the payback in Deuces Wild is tied up in the royal flush and quad deuce hands. From my experience, hit one or more of these two in a day and you are going to at least break even. Quad Deuces come on average about of one out of every 5,000 hands. They also have a bad habit of not showing up for a long period of time. I have gone as long as 20,000 hands between them.
